Found in Bletchley just off of the main roundabout. You cannot miss it. Parking underneath in the dry, and parking outside. .escalators on entrance and stairs and lift. Toilets by the entrance on the first floor. A cafe available. Another eating area by the exit. A typical IKEA with walkways that take you around the shop. In certain areas you can cut corners and cut sections out, but generally you have to follow the walkways with everyone else. The tills have now changed and are a filter section and you're guided to a free till once you reach the front. Avoid at weekends.... I cannot say this enough, its so packed at the weekends, and unless you want to get squished... avoid !! It's currently open until 9pm in the evenings... so plenty of time to go then !! Till service was fast despite the queues.....
